Output 271fe952776159ab52a63f786484361922dfddd1df9ab330ed084fd6d3cd331f:0

value
2685083
script pubkey
OP_0 OP_PUSHBYTES_20 15bb5ea29b256779eded30267389c5a4e1061206
address
bc1qzka4ag5my4nhnm0dxqn88zw95nssvysxzyxsuq
transaction
271fe952776159ab52a63f786484361922dfddd1df9ab330ed084fd6d3cd331f
spent
true